    2. DESCRIPTION OF SERVICE

    DayClose Legal is a mobile-first AI-assisted legal billing and time capture platform that enables attorneys to capture billable time through voice recording, document scanning, and manual entry. The Service uses artificial intelligence to transcribe voice recordings, match captures to legal matters, and generate draft billing entries for attorney review and approval. The Service is designed as a tool to assist licensed attorneys in their billing practices. The Service does not practice law, provide legal advice, or make billing decisions on behalf of attorneys.


    3. ATTORNEY RESPONSIBILITY AND AI SUPERVISION

    3.1 You acknowledge that all AI-generated content produced by the Service including billing narratives, matter matches, time entries, and suggestions are drafts requiring your review and approval before use.

    3.2 No AI-generated content becomes a billing record without your explicit approval action. You retain full professional responsibility for all billing entries submitted to clients regardless of whether those entries were AI-assisted.

    3.3 You agree to supervise all AI-generated content in compliance with ABA Model Rule 5.3 and any applicable state bar rules governing the supervision of nonlawyer assistance and the use of technology in legal practice.

    3.4 The Company makes no representation that the Service satisfies any specific state bar requirement or ethical obligation. You are responsible for ensuring your use of the Service complies with all applicable professional conduct rules in your jurisdiction.

    5. CLIENT CONFIDENTIALITY AND DATA HANDLING

    5.1 You acknowledge that information entered into the Service may include confidential client information subject to attorney-client privilege and professional confidentiality obligations under ABA Model Rule 1.6 and applicable state rules.

    5.2 The Company implements technical and organizational measures to protect confidential information as described in our Privacy Policy. However you remain solely responsible for ensuring your use of the Service complies with your confidentiality obligations to clients.

    5.3 You agree not to enter into the Service any information that you are prohibited from disclosing to third party technology providers under applicable law, court order, or client agreement without first obtaining any required consent or authorization.

    5.4 The Company does not use client matter data, billing entries, or captured content to train AI models without explicit firm-level consent. This setting defaults to off and must be affirmatively enabled by the firm administrator.


    6. TRUST ACCOUNTS

    6.1 The Service does not process, manage, or handle client trust account funds.

    6.2 Trust account balance information displayed in the Service is for reference only and is not a substitute for proper trust accounting records maintained in compliance with ABA Model Rule 1.15 and applicable state IOLTA rules.

    6.3 You remain solely responsible for maintaining accurate trust account records in compliance with all applicable professional conduct rules.
